In July 2017, bitcoin miners and mining companies representing approximately 80% to 90% of the networks computing power voted to incorporate a program that would reduce the amount of data needed to confirm each block. In other words, they went with Solution 1.

The app which miners voted to add to the bitcoin protocol is called a segregated witness, or SegWit. This term is an amalgamation of Segregated, meaning to separate, and Witness, which describes signatures on a bitcoin transaction. Segregated Witness, then, means to separate transaction signatures out of a block and join them as an extended block.

Less than a month later in August 2017, a group of miners and developers initiated a tricky disk, leaving the bitcoin network to create a new currency using the identical codebase as bitcoin. Though this group agreed with the need for a solution to scaling, they feared adopting segregated witness technology would not completely address the scaling problem. .

Instead, they went with Solution 2. The resulting currency, called bitcoin cash, increased the blocksize to 8 Mb in order to accelerate the verification process to permit a performance of around two million transactions every day.
